What Is BIS Certification and Why Is It Important?

The Bureau of Indian Standards (BIS) is the national body in India responsible for maintaining quality, safety, and performance standards across a wide range of products. To ensure consumer safety and product reliability, BIS mandates certification under the Compulsory Registration Scheme (CRS) for several electronic goods — including LED flood lights.

The BIS CRS Certification for LED flood lights is a mark of approval indicating the product has been tested and complies with the Indian Standard IS 10322 (Part 5/Section 5): 2013. This not only ensures safety and performance but also makes your product legally eligible for sale in India.

BIS CRS Certification for LED Flood Lights: Step-by-Step Process

Let’s simplify the certification process in seven easy steps:

Identify Product and Applicable Standard

Your product must fall under the category of LED flood lights as defined by IS 10322 (Part 5/Section 5): 2013. The first step is to verify your product type and understand the applicable safety and performance criteria.

 Testing at BIS Recognized Lab

Send product samples to a BIS-approved laboratory in India. The lab will:

  • Conduct tests on electrical safety, luminance, thermal performance, and endurance

  • Generate a detailed test report that confirms the product meets BIS requirements

Without this report, the certification process cannot proceed.

 Prepare Required Documentation

The following documents are typically required:

  • Business registration certificate

  • Product test report

  • Technical specifications and product manual

  • Brand authorization letter (if applying for third-party brands)

  • Factory address and manufacturing flow

  • Import Export Code (for overseas applicants)

  • Identity proof and photograph of the Authorized Signatory

Online Application on BIS Portal

Create an account on the and fill out the online application form. Upload the necessary documents, test report, and pay the applicable processing fees.

 Factory Audit (For Foreign Manufacturers Only)

If you're a foreign manufacturer, BIS will conduct a factory audit to inspect production practices and verify compliance with Indian standards. The audit includes:

  • Checking manufacturing facilities

  • Reviewing quality control processes

  • Verifying product consistency

Grant of BIS Registration

If everything is in order, BIS issues the Registration Certificate. Your product is now officially approved to carry the BIS Standard Mark.

 Use of BIS Logo and Market Launch

After certification, all your LED flood lights must bear the BIS registration number and logo before being sold. This assures buyers and government agencies that the product is compliant.

Timeframe and Costs Involved

  • Testing Time: 2–3 weeks

  • Application Processing Time: 1–2 weeks

  • Factory Audit (for foreign brands): 3–4 weeks extra

  • Total Duration: Typically 4–6 weeks

  • Cost Range:

    • Lab testing fees (varies)

    • BIS application fee (nominal)

    • Professional consultancy (optional)

    • Factory inspection costs (for overseas)

Who Should Apply for BIS CRS for LED Flood Lights?

  • Domestic manufacturers operating within India

  • Importers/Distributors bringing in foreign-manufactured LED flood lights

  • Foreign manufacturers selling products in India (must appoint an Authorized Indian Representative)

Maintaining and Renewing BIS Certification

The BIS certification is valid for 2 years. Renewal requires:

  • Fresh test report (if needed)

  • Updated documents

  • Online renewal form and fee payment

Ensure your certification is renewed before expiration to avoid business disruptions.

Frequently Asked Questions 

Q1. Is BIS CRS certification mandatory for LED flood lights?

Yes. As per the Indian government’s regulations, LED flood lights must be BIS-certified under IS 10322 (Part 5/Section 5): 2013 before being sold in India.

Q2. What is the role of BIS CRS in ensuring product safety?

The BIS CRS for LED flood lights ensures products meet electrical safety, luminance, and thermal performance standards, reducing risks of fire, failure, and energy wastage.

Q3. Can foreign manufacturers apply for BIS certification?

Yes. However, they must appoint an Authorized Indian Representative (AIR) to handle certification processes in India.

Q4. How long does the BIS CRS certification process take?

On average, the process takes 4–6 weeks from testing to final approval, depending on the completeness of documentation and product readiness.

Q5. What happens if I sell LED flood lights without BIS certification?

Selling non-certified products is illegal in India. It can lead to fines, product seizure, and legal penalties.
